Assemblymember Chris Holden is seeking nominations for his 41st District’s 2018 Women of Distinction.

The district’s Woman of the Year will be invited to the State Capitol to be introduced on the Assembly Floor and be given a special resolution honoring her contributions to the community and the state.

The Women of Distinction, and Woman of the Year, will be recognized at Holden’s Annual Spring Open House (date to be announced). Only one nomination form is needed.

• Open to all women who live or work in the 41st Assembly District: La Verne, Monrovia, South Pasadena, Upland, Claremont, Pasadena, Altadena, Rancho Cucamonga, Sierra Madre, or San Dimas.

• The selection committee will select one woman to be honored from each city listed and among those selected; one woman will be selected as the 41st Assembly District Woman of the Year where she will be honored at a special ceremony in March 2018 at the State Capitol.

• Submit completed nomination form by deadline. Applications available online at www.asmdc.org/holden

• No self-nominations.
